FDMS0312AS. Аналоги и основные параметры
Наименование производителя: FDMS0312AS
Тип транзистора: MOSFET
Полярность: N
Предельные значения
Pd ⓘ - Максимальная рассеиваемая мощность: 2.5 W
|Vds|ⓘ - Максимально допустимое напряжение сток-исток: 30 V
|Vgs|ⓘ - Максимально допустимое напряжение затвор-исток: 20 V
|Id| ⓘ - Максимально допустимый постоянный ток стока: 18 A
Tj ⓘ - Максимальная температура канала: 150 °C
Электрические характеристики
tr ⓘ - Время нарастания: 2.3 ns
Cossⓘ - Выходная емкость: 550 pf
RDSonⓘ - Сопротивление сток-исток открытого транзистора: 0.005 Ohm
Тип корпуса: PQFN5X6
